2012 U.S. Open Tennis: Serena Williams, Roberta Vinci Advance To Quarterfinals

The U.S. Open women's quarterfinals bracket is all set after Serena Williams defeated Andrea Hlavackova on Monday, with Italy's Roberta Vinci upsetting Agnieszka Radwanska to advance.

No. 4 seed Serena Williams dominated Hlavackova in the match, 6-0, 6-0, with the American winning 76 percent of first serve points in the match and the Czech managing just nine winners in the 12 games. Williams will move on to face No. 12 Ana Ivanovic in the quarterfinals.

The big upset of the day came when No. 20 Roberta Vinci of Italy defeated Poland's Radwanska, the No. 2 seed in the tournament, 6-1, 6-4. Vinci took advantage of a rather lackluster performance by Radwanska, and will take on No. 10 Sara Errani of Italy in the next round.

The men's round of 16 continues tonight, with No. 3 Andy Murray facing No. 15 Milos Raonic on the main court tonight at Arthur Ashe Stadium.
